Role is 100% remote. The work hours will be US EST (eastern) hours (2 PM to 10 PM UK time), so the resource will need to support those hours. We are seeking an experienced Murex Front Office / ERM Consultant with strong expertise in Market Risk, Credit Risk (MLC), and xVA. The ideal candidate will work closely with front office, risk, and IT teams to deliver high-quality solutions on the Murex MX.3 platform, supporting pricing, risk management, and regulatory requirements across financial products.
Responsibilities:
- Configure, implement, and support Murex MX.3 Front Office and ERM modules (Market Risk, Credit Risk/MLC, xVA, MRB).
- Ensure alignment of system setup with business requirements and regulatory standards.
- Translate business needs into functional and technical specifications.
- Support a wide range of financial instruments, including derivatives and fixed income products.
- Provide expertise in pricing models, valuation, and risk metrics.
- Configure Murex workflows, pricing models, risk calculations, and reporting frameworks.
- Implement enhancements and support ongoing system upgrades.
- Provide L2/L3 production support for the Murex platform.
- Troubleshoot issues, perform root cause analysis, and ensure timely resolution.
- Ensure compliance with market risk, credit risk, and regulatory reporting requirements.
- Support audit and regulatory initiatives.
- Identify opportunities for automation, performance optimization, and process efficiency improvements.
- Contribute to best practices and knowledge sharing within the team.
Technical Skills:
- 6β12+ years of experience in Murex Front Office and ERM modules.
- Strong expertise in Market Risk, Credit Risk (MLC), xVA.
- Hands-on experience with MX.3 ERM modules (MLC / XVA / MRB).
- Proficient in SQL, XML, Unix, Scripting.
Domain Knowledge:
- Minimum 2β3 years of experience in financial markets and products.
- Strong understanding of trade lifecycle, pricing and valuation, and risk management concepts.
